What's The Definition Of Lurch?
lurch
verb: To lurch means to make a sudden movement, especially forwards, in an uncontrolled way. lurch in American English 1 intransitive verb: to roll or pitch suddenly noun: an act or instance of swaying abruptly lurch in American English 2 noun: a situation at the close of various games in which the loser scores nothing or is far behind the opponent lurch in American English 3 intransitive verb: to lurk near a place; prowl noun: the act of lurking or state of watchfulness transitive verb: to do out of; defraud; cheat lurch in British English 1 to lean or pitch suddenly to one side noun: the act or an instance of lurching lurch in British English 2 noun lurch in British English 3 verb: to prowl or steal about suspiciously |
